Ответить Новая тема Новый опрос 
Всего: 4 < 1 2 3 4 >
 Номер заказа
mracula


Новичок
Сообщений: 14
Регистрация: 20-06-2016


07-10-2016 12:38
Поставил с нуля Престу (вдруг сторонние модули влияют)
Вставил код через Notepad++
в итоге сайт просто не работает!
 
Вне форума
ПМ 
Щелкните, и это сообщение будет добавлено в ваш ответ как цитата Цитировать этот ответ
Triton63


Профессионал
Сообщений: 886
Откуда: Оренбург
Регистрация: 28-05-2011


07-10-2016 13:02
А можно измененый файл посмотреть, прикрепи к сообщению
 



Интернет-магазин ионизатор воздуха ЭкоЮнит: Лампа Чижевского
shop.aeroion.ru
-------------------------------------------------------------------------------
Вне форума
ПМ Отправить эл.сообщение 
Щелкните, и это сообщение будет добавлено в ваш ответ как цитата Цитировать этот ответ
mracula


Новичок
Сообщений: 14
Регистрация: 20-06-2016


07-10-2016 13:15
Цитата:( Triton63 @ 07-10-2016 11:02 Смотреть сообщение )
А можно измененый файл посмотреть, прикрепи к сообщению


Вот, пожалуйста!


Вложения:

Вложения Order.php( Размер файла: 88.54KB Скачиваний: 2935 )
 
Вне форума
ПМ 
Щелкните, и это сообщение будет добавлено в ваш ответ как цитата Цитировать этот ответ
Triton63


Профессионал
Сообщений: 886
Откуда: Оренбург
Регистрация: 28-05-2011


07-10-2016 13:31
Строка 2142 лишняя скобка
}
 



Интернет-магазин ионизатор воздуха ЭкоЮнит: Лампа Чижевского
shop.aeroion.ru
-------------------------------------------------------------------------------
Вне форума
ПМ Отправить эл.сообщение 
Щелкните, и это сообщение будет добавлено в ваш ответ как цитата Цитировать этот ответ
Triton63


Профессионал
Сообщений: 886
Откуда: Оренбург
Регистрация: 28-05-2011


07-10-2016 13:33
надо
Код:
public function getUniqReference()
        {
            return '№'.$this->id;
        }


у тебя

Код:
public function getUniqReference()
    {
        return '№'.$this->id;
      }
    }


и кодировку файла смени на UTF-8 без BOM


Сообщение отредактировал Triton63 (07-10-2016 11:37)
 
Репутация: 5 | Поставил: mracula



Интернет-магазин ионизатор воздуха ЭкоЮнит: Лампа Чижевского
shop.aeroion.ru
-------------------------------------------------------------------------------
Вне форума
ПМ Отправить эл.сообщение 
Щелкните, и это сообщение будет добавлено в ваш ответ как цитата Цитировать этот ответ
mracula


Новичок
Сообщений: 14
Регистрация: 20-06-2016


07-10-2016 13:46
Спасибо, без скобки стало работать.
 
Вне форума
ПМ 
Щелкните, и это сообщение будет добавлено в ваш ответ как цитата Цитировать этот ответ
mracula


Новичок
Сообщений: 14
Регистрация: 20-06-2016


07-10-2016 14:19
Только теперь отслеживание заказа не работает.
 
Вне форума
ПМ 
Щелкните, и это сообщение будет добавлено в ваш ответ как цитата Цитировать этот ответ
mracula


Новичок
Сообщений: 14
Регистрация: 20-06-2016


07-10-2016 16:17
Цитата:( Triton63 @ 07-10-2016 11:33 Смотреть сообщение )
надо
Код:
public function getUniqReference()
        {
            return '№'.$this-&gt;id;
        }


у тебя

Код:
public function getUniqReference()
    {
        return '№'.$this-&gt;id;
      }
    }


и кодировку файла смени на UTF-8 без BOM

Повело мое зрение скобочки не заметил лишние. Теперь все работает. Только клиент не получает номер по которому можно отследить заказ. Что делать? Либо вообще убрать отслеживание заказа или есть варианты.

К админу почта приходит с этим номером.
 
Вне форума
ПМ 
Щелкните, и это сообщение будет добавлено в ваш ответ как цитата Цитировать этот ответ
mracula


Новичок
Сообщений: 14
Регистрация: 20-06-2016


07-10-2016 18:00
Цитата:( ggyyvv @ 21-08-2015 17:51 Смотреть сообщение )
Алекс, спасибо! нашел в order-confirmation.tpl

id_order={$reference_order|urlencode} поменял на id_order={$id_order|urlencode} и все заработало

для красоты также подправил guest-tracking.tpl - вместо
{l s='For example: QIIXJXNUI or QIIXJXNUI#1'} исправил на {l s='For example: 115 or 115#1'} и внес соответствующие исправления в перевод

P.S. нашел $reference еще в ..\pdf\supply-order-header.tpl, но не совсем понял, в какой форме это отображается...

Так же правил, в order-confirmation.tpl

Но насколько я понимаю код заказа и номер заказа разные вещи.

Переходим по ссылке в письме "Если у вас гостевая учетная запись, вы можете следить за заказом через "Гостевое отслеживание" в нашем магазине."
Переходим на отслеживание заказа и там вместо кода указан номер заказа (т.е id)

guest-tracking пишет: не правильный код заказа. А если подставить код заказа который приходит на почту админу или просто взять из админки, то тогда работает.
 
Вне форума
ПМ 
Щелкните, и это сообщение будет добавлено в ваш ответ как цитата Цитировать этот ответ
mracula


Новичок
Сообщений: 14
Регистрация: 20-06-2016


07-10-2016 18:49
Как сделать чтоб в письме клиенту приходил и номер заказа и номер отслеживания?


Сообщение отредактировал mracula (07-10-2016 16:50)
 
Вне форума
ПМ 
Щелкните, и это сообщение будет добавлено в ваш ответ как цитата Цитировать этот ответ
Ответить Новая тема Новый опрос 
Всего: 4 < 1 2 3 4 >